createssh for Dummies
createssh for Dummies
Blog Article
If you'd like to make use of a components protection key to authenticate to GitHub, it's essential to generate a fresh SSH critical to your hardware security important. You have to link your hardware stability essential in your Personal computer after you authenticate Using the vital pair. For more info, begin to see the OpenSSH 8.two release notes.
We will make this happen by outputting the written content of our public SSH vital on our area Personal computer and piping it via an SSH relationship towards the remote server.
This text has furnished a few ways of building SSH essential pairs on the Home windows system. Use the SSH keys to connect to a distant procedure devoid of applying passwords.
With that, whenever you operate ssh it will eventually seek out keys in Keychain Entry. If it finds 1, you will not be prompted for any password. Keys will also instantly be added to ssh-agent every time you restart your equipment.
Once you've entered your passphrase in a terminal session, you won't have to enter it once more for providing you have that terminal window open. You could link and disconnect from as quite a few remote periods as you like, with out coming into your passphrase once again.
The non-public critical is retained from the client and may be kept Completely secret. Any compromise of your private crucial enables the attacker to log into servers which are configured with the associated general public essential without having extra authentication. As yet another precaution, the key may be encrypted on disk which has a passphrase.
Any attacker hoping to crack the non-public SSH crucial passphrase should have already got use of the process. Therefore they can already have access to your person account or the basis account.
They are a more secure way to attach than passwords. We demonstrate tips on how to create, install, and use SSH keys in Linux.
When you are prompted to "Enter a file in which to save The main element", it is possible to push Enter to simply accept the default file spot. Make sure you Be aware that should you created SSH keys Earlier, ssh-keygen might ask you to rewrite A further crucial, during which circumstance we propose developing a tailor made-named SSH key. To do so, kind the default file locale and replace id_ALGORITHM using your customized crucial title.
-b “Bits” This feature specifies the number of bits in The real key. The laws that govern the use circumstance for SSH may perhaps have to have a particular important length for use. On the whole, 2048 bits is considered to be sufficient for RSA keys.
You could dismiss the "randomart" which is exhibited. Some distant pcs could teach you their random art every time you hook up. The reasoning is that you'll identify In the event the random artwork variations, and be suspicious from the relationship as it suggests the SSH keys for createssh that server have been altered.
To make use of general public essential authentication, the public critical has to be copied to a server and put in in an authorized_keys file. This may be conveniently carried out utilizing the ssh-copy-id Resource. Like this:
You could form !ref During this text region to rapidly research our entire list of tutorials, documentation & Market choices and insert the website link!
It's important to make certain There is certainly ample unpredictable entropy while in the process when SSH keys are produced. There are incidents when Countless equipment on the web have shared the same host key when they were being improperly configured to deliver The real key without the need of good randomness.